Job duties for this position include the following:

Responsible for greeting and preparing patients for the health care provider while maintaining a positive and caring attitude.

  • Responsible for monitoring, tracking and assisting patients during office visits.
  • Responsible for patient safety and protection of patient privacy rights by observing HIPAA regulations.
  • Obtains and accurately records patient information; vital signs, height, weight, allergies, current medications, and all medical history in the EMR.
  • Responsible for updating charts and tracking paperwork to completion.
  • Responsible for cleaning and preparing examination rooms, equipment, and tools per protocol.
  • Accurately documents patient plan(s) of care, tests and examination results in the medical record as directed by the provider.
  • Responsible for preparing, cleaning and sterilizing instruments and maintaining equipment; stock in patient exam rooms while maintaining cleanliness and organization and disposes of contaminated items according to protocol.
  • Answers the phones, sends timely messages to the provider and refills medications as per guidelines stated in the clinic.
  • Floats as Patient Services Representatives at the front desk as needed.
  • Assists with the Infusion Suite as needed.
  • Other duties as assigned.

The qualifications for this role include the following:

  • Successful completion of an Accredited National Certification Exam (i.e.: AAMA or AMT) for
  • Certified Medical Assistant (CMA) or Registered Medical Assistant (RMA)
  • One (1) year of Medical Assistant experience.
  • High School degree or equivalent.
  • Experience in a clinical setting.
  • Experience and ability to navigate an EMR.
  • Solid assessment, clinical, and documentation skills.
